Output 14271656e3f13e3baf245811864316b588bfe69d5cd84612c5801f4589a7c515:0

value
4338697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868ab4a25d47f5599b3808ee2f7e5d7df301d711 OP_EQUAL
address
3DxQdgahBqaAidc91hMPdsEEMhzaZs4K1m
transaction
14271656e3f13e3baf245811864316b588bfe69d5cd84612c5801f4589a7c515